REMOVE THE CUTTING BLADE AND
INSTALL THE CUTTING ATTACHMENT

Remove the Cutting Blade

1. Align the shaft bushing hole with the locking rod slot

and insert the locking rod into the bushing hole (Fig. 7).

2. Hold the locking rod in place by grasping it next to

the boom of the unit (Fig. 13).

3. While holding the locking rod, loosen the nut on the

blade by turning it clockwise with the supplied wrench
(or a 13 mm closed-end or socket wrench) (Fig. 13).

7. Put the blade retainer and nut on the output shaft.

Make sure that the blade is installed correctly.

8. Tighten nut counterclockwise against the blade while

holding the locking rod:

• If using a torque wrench and an 13 mm socket tighten

to: 325 - 335 in•lb, 27 - 28 ft.•lb, 37 - 38 N•m.

• Without a torque wrench, use a 13 mm closed-end or

socket wrench, turning the nut until the blade retainer
is snug against the shaft bushing. Make sure that the
blade is installed correctly, then rotate the nut an
additional 1/4 to 1/2 turn counterclockwise (Fig. 12).

Install the Cutting Attachment

5. Align the shaft bushing hole with the locking rod slot and

insert the locking rod into the shaft bushing hole (Fig. 7).
Place the blade retainer on the output shaft with the flat
surface against the output shaft bushing (Fig. 14). Screw
the cutting attachment counterclockwise onto the output
shaft. Tighten securely.

NOTE: The blade retainer must be installed on the output

shaft in the position shown for the cutting
attachment to work correctly.

WARNING:

Do not sharpen the
cutting blade.

Sharpening the blade can cause the blade tip
to break off while in use. This can result in
severe personal injury. Replace the blade.
